Abstract EN

Insects can cause a major loss in stored grain, and early identification and monitoring of insects become necessary for applying corrective action.

Considering the effectiveness and practicability, an image processing approach and the corresponding application embedded in smartphones are proposed to identify and count the insects.

For the insect images acquired by mobile phones, one sliding window-based binarization is adopted to release their nonuniform brightness, and then connected domain-based histogram statistics is presented to identify and count the insects in stored grain.

Finally, the experiments are performed on the corresponding application based on Android, and it has shown that the proposed approach can be applicable for different random insect images from mobile phones with the counting accuracy of 95%, which is superior to the traditional approach.
